Substituting Condensed Milk with Evaporated Milk With Sugar
4.0 (1)
Contains Dairy
You will need:
1cupEvaporated Milk
1¼cupGranulated Sugar
Substitution ratio: 1 cup Condensed Milk = 1 cup Evaporated Milk + 1¼ cup Granulated Sugar
Effects on Your Baking
The flavor is close but not identical. Commercial condensed milk has a slightly caramelized, cooked milk flavor from the long reduction process. Your homemade version will be sweeter and slightly less complex, but in most recipes the difference is masked by other ingredients.
